feminine noun
a. sunstroke
Me quedé dormido al sol y me dio una terrible insolación.I fell asleep in the sun and I got terrible sunstroke.
a. sunshine
En Islandia, la insolación puede durar solo dos o tres horas durante el invierno.In winter in Iceland there may be only two or three hours of sunshine.
b. insolation
A word or phrase that is only used by experts, professionals, or academics in a particular field (e.g., exposition).
(technical)
Una mayor insolación ocasiona cambios en los océanos del planeta.Increased insolation gives rise to changes in the world's oceans.
